Get ready for an electrifying clash in the Belgian Pro League as Union Saint-Gilloise prepares to host Royal Charleroi SC at the Stade Joseph Marien. Kick-off is scheduled for 15:45 on Saturday, 18 October 2025, and anticipation is building for what promises to be a thrilling encounter.
Union's Home Advantage
Union Saint-Gilloise will be looking to capitalize on their home advantage and extend their impressive run of form. They've secured four consecutive home victories, demonstrating their strength on familiar turf. However, their recent away defeat to Club Brugge (1-0) serves as a reminder that consistency is key. The team will be aiming to improve their possession and attacking efficiency in this upcoming match.
Charleroi's Struggles
On the other hand, Royal Charleroi SC has been facing challenges, having lost their previous three games. A recent 2-1 defeat against Gent highlighted their struggles. Despite a goal from Patrick Pflucke, they were unable to secure a positive result. Charleroi will need to address their defensive vulnerabilities and improve their overall performance to compete effectively against Union.
Head-to-Head Dominance
Historically, Union Saint-Gilloise has held the upper hand in their encounters with Charleroi. In their last meeting at Stade du Pays de Charleroi, Union emerged victorious with a 2-1 away win. In fact, Union has won every one of the previous 8 head-to-head games. This historical dominance could provide a psychological advantage as they prepare for this upcoming match.
Key Statistics to Watch
Union Saint-Gilloise has displayed strong attacking prowess, averaging 1.9 goals from 5.3 shots on goal in their last 10 league games. Promise David, Kevin Rodriguez, and Raul Florucz have been instrumental in their goal-scoring efforts, each netting 4 goals. Charleroi will need to find a way to contain these key players to stand a chance of securing a positive result. Union averages 52% possession and 4.8 corners per game.
